Responsibilities:
Under their scope of practice and in collaboration with patients and the health care team, the Licensed Practical Nurse provides care for patients with defined health challenges and predicatable outcomes. As the acuity or complexity increases and/or outcomes are not predictable, the LPN, under the supervision of the Registered Nurse, provides nursing interventions, within their scope of practice. The RN retains accountability for the assignment and/or delegation of patient care activities to the LPN, but the LPN is accountable for individual actions or practices.
